From Port Debilly to the Iconic Paris Landmarks

Paris : Seine River Lunch cruise from Eiffel Tower - From Port Debilly to the Iconic Paris Landmarks

During the 2-hour cruise, you’ll pass by several of Paris’s most famous sights. The itinerary includes sightseeing stops at Pont Alexandre III, renowned for its ornate design, and the Notre Dame Cathedral, one of the city’s most celebrated Gothic structures. You will also see Conciergerie, historically significant as a former royal palace and prison.

The Statue of Liberty replica in Paris is another highlight visible from the boat. The itinerary concludes back at Port Debilly, completing a loop of the city’s most recognizable monuments. The scenic route highlights the grandeur of Paris from a distinctive vantage point, with the Eiffel Tower facing the boat, creating a memorable backdrop throughout the cruise.

Practical Information for Your Booking

The meeting point is at Port Debilly, accessible from Passerelle Debilly or Trocadéro. Guests should arrive 30 minutes prior to boarding. Reservations can be made with free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ance, offering flexibility in case of changes.

The boat is called Tosca, and special requests like window seats, birthday cakes, or roses can be arranged in advance for an additional cost. Note that pets and people with mobility impairments are not permitted on this cruise.
